Bobo, the clown, wants to set the world record for the furthest range traveled by a clown shot out of a cannon. Write a sentence describing the cannon that Bobo would need to use to accomplish this feat. Be sure to include the necessary initial velocity and the required angle of the cannon. Score: 0 / 1

Answers

In the human cannonball act makes use of of a special type of "cannon" that more safely ejects a person who acts as the "cannonball"

The world record for the longest flight by a human cannonball is approximately 194 feet and therefore the human cannon catapult that Bobo would need is one that would be able to propel him with an initial velocity of more than 120 kilometer per hour (more than the speed of the current record holder) with the cannon directed at an angle 45 degrees above the horizonal

The reason the values given above are correct is as follows:

The world record of the furthest range of the human cannonball is 193 ft. 8.8 inches. The maximum claim for the furthest range of a human cannonball is 200 ft. 4 in. Therefore, to safely set the world record would be to reach a range of 194 feet

The speed with which the world record was accomplished (120 km/jhr)  should be expected to be exceeded given, horizontal speed in free fall motion is constant (decreasing in the presence of drag), and the conditions are likely to be more or less similar

In order to reach the furthest range, R, at the possible speed, the angle of inclination of the "cannon" required is 45°, according to the range formula, which is given as follows;

[tex]Range, \ R = \dfrac{v^2 \times sin(2\cdot \theta)}{g}[/tex]

The maximum range is given where θ = 45, such that sin(2·θ) = sin(90°) = 1

A further range than the world record van be obtained using the above values

A wheel of mass 4kg is pulled up a plane inclined at 30° to the horizontal by a force of 45N applied to the axle and parallel to the plane. If the wheel has a radius of 0.5m and the moment of inertia 0.5kgm?, calculate the translational velocity acquired after travelling 12m up the plane, assuming the wheel is initially at rest (6 marks)​

Answers

Answer:

v = 10 m/s

Explanation:

Let's assume the wheel does not slip as it accelerates.

Energy theory is more straightforward than kinematics in my opinion.

Work done on the wheel

W = Fd = 45(12) = 540 J

Some is converted to potential energy

PE = mgh = 4(9.8)12sin30 = 235.2 J

As there is no friction mentioned, the remainder is kinetic energy

KE = 540 - 235.2 = 304.8 J

KE = ½mv² + ½Iω²

ω = v/R

KE = ½mv² + ½I(v/R)² = ½(m + I/R²)v²

v = √(2KE / (m + I/R²))

v = √(2(304.8) / (4 + 0.5/0.5²)) = √101.6

v = 10.07968...
